Controller code execution via unvalidated LDAP referrals
Published May 27, 2026 · Updated May 27, 2026
SSRF in Jenkins LDAP Plugin 807.v7d7de30930cf and earlier allows attackers to reach attacker-controlled RMI services via LDAP referrals. The plugin follows referral URLs returned by the configured LDAP server, allowing an RMI endpoint to supply attacker-controlled serialized data to Jenkins. Code execution on the controller requires control of that LDAP server or a machine-in-the-middle position and suitable deserialization gadgets on the classpath.
